Product & Market Characteristics (Functional vs. Innovative)

Functional products

  • Long life cycles: > 2 years
  • Low variation by category: ~10–20 variations or less
  • High volume per SKU: many physical units per SKU
  • Forecasting: relatively easy, high accuracy
  • Stockout tolerance / shortages: ~1–2%
  • Discounting (markdowns): ~0% (rarely needed)
  • Unit economics: lower unit margin at normal prices
  • Example: white shirts (stable demand, many uses)

Innovative products

  • Short life cycles: ~3 months to 1 year
  • High variation per category: many variations
  • Low volume per SKU: few units per SKU
  • Forecasting: difficult forecasting, higher forecast error
  • Stockout tolerance / shortages: higher allowed; ~10–40% excess inventory at season end
  • Discounting (markdowns): ~10–20%
  • Unit economics: higher unit margin at normal prices
  • Example: patterned shirts/clothing (trend-driven, volatile demand)

Supply Chain Strategy Playbook (3 strategies)

1) Efficiency Strategy (Lean / “Link”)

Best for: Functional products

  • Primary goal: reduce cost
  • Facility location: low-wage production locations
  • Production system: high/optimized production system capability
  • Inventory approach: minimize inventory levels
  • Transportation: full truck/container loads (cost efficiency via full utilization)
  • Supplier strategy: prioritize price + quality

2) Responsive Strategy (“Spelling”)

Best for: Innovative products

  • Primary goal: speed + flexibility
  • Facility location: closer to market; access to skilled labor & adequate technology
  • Production system: flexible production + extra capacity
  • Inventory approach: maintain safety stock in the right locations
  • Transportation: fast transport as needed
  • Supplier strategy: prioritize speed + flexibility + quality
  • Product development tactic: use design models / highly differentiable product designs to enable responsiveness

3) Fit Strategy

Purpose: align supply chain strategy with product/market characteristics and needs so the network can “survive and excel.”

Handling Demand Uncertainty (4 options)

  1. Capacity strategy (“Cash strategy”)

    • Adjust capacity via hiring/firing, overtime, or outsourcing
    • Tradeoff: costs of changing capacity
  2. Inventory strategy (“Level strategy”)

    • Hold fixed capacity and build inventory when demand is low; use it when demand rises
    • Tradeoff: high storage costs
    • Applies best when: selling horizon/mass is relatively long
  3. Backlog strategy (“Lost Sales”)

    • Fill only part of demand; unfulfilled requests are delayed to the next period
    • If customers won’t wait: lost sales opportunities
    • Used to: avoid excessive cost of inventory/capacity changes
  4. Hybrid strategy

    • Combine some/all of capacity, inventory, and backlog approaches
    • Choice depends on organizational goals:
      • maximize profits vs. minimize costs
